Two Linear Distinguishing Attacks on VMPC and RC4A and Weakness of RC4 Family of Stream Ciphers (Corrected)
Alexander Maximov
Abstract: At FSE 2004 two new stream ciphers VMPC and RC4A have been proposed.
VMPC is a generalisation of the stream cipher RC4, whereas RC4A is an
attempt to increase the security of RC4 by introducing an additional
permuter in the design. This paper is the first work
presenting attacks on VMPC and RC4A. We propose two linear
distinguishing attacks, one on VMPC of complexity $2^{39.97}$, and
one on RC4A of complexity $2^{58}$. We investigate the RC4 family of
stream ciphers and show some theoretical weaknesses of such constructions.
